title: Too Much Information?
fandom: The Sentinel
characters: Simon, Jim, Blair
word count: 100 exactly. BOOYAH! \o/
rating: G
Captain Simon Banks of the Cascade Police Department, Major Crimes Division, opened his office door. Waiting for him on the other side were Jim Ellison, one of his best detectives, and Ellison's partner Blair Sandburg, special consultant to the CPD.
“ – don't see how my hair care products take up any more space than your chest waxing kit,” Blair was saying.
There was a beat of silence, and then Jim and Blair both turned to look at Simon, pretending they hadn't been having a personal conversation in his office. He closed the door and chose to join them in that act.
